what is the degree of polynomial
f (x) = 2x² - 5x+6 ?​

Answer:

degree 2

Step-by-step explanation:

The degree of a polynomial is determined by the largest value of the exponent attached to the variable.

f(x) = 2x² - 5x + 6 ← has the term 2x² with exponent 2 ( largest ), then

f(x) is a polynomial of degree 2
